How To Write and Sell Your Own e-Book
by Michael Cheney
More and more people are starting to realize that one of the best
ways to generate revenue on the Internet is to write and sell your own e-Book.
It’s a lot easier than you think.
The first step you’ll need to take is focusing on a key area that is
of interest and passion to you. There’s no point in starting to write
a book and trying to sell it if it’s not something you are passionately
interested in.
Writing a book itself can be a bit of a task, but there are some shortcuts
you can take. One idea is to approach existing authors and ask to use their
work as part of the book. This helps you get a larger book quickly.
You could also contact some leading figures in your sector and ask them for
case studies, stories or background information on their own businesses. In
return, they would get coverage in your book and maybe links through to their
website and you’d get the free content. This way you end up with original
and unique content from trusted sources in your sector and it is a great way
to start getting a book pulled together very quickly.
Alternatively, if you don’t want to write a book or create a book at
all, what you can do is use an existing e-Book. There are lots of e-Books on
the Internet that are for sale or
that you can use with permission without having to pay at all. These e-Books
work by actually including affiliate links within them so that the original
authors get paid every time someone clicks on a link and orders something. You
can get the rights to redistribute these books and either put a price tag on
them or include your own affiliate links somewhere in the book.
So there are different routes to take, from actually creating your own e-Book
to getting one off the shelf. But once the e-Book itself is ready you’ll
need to get a cover for it.
Having an actual image of a product, even though it’s a virtual product,
has a dramatic effect on how many you will sell and your ability to convince
visitors to your website that the product is worth investing in.
There are some great pieces of software that will actually create e-Book covers
for you. You could also use a graphic designer to create your e-Book cover,
but this could be very expensive and time consuming. The main benefits to getting
an excellent e-Book cover are that it’s easier, not just for you to sell
your book, but it also makes it easier for affiliates that you may have to promote
your book as well. When your e-Book cover actually looks like a physical product,
people will be more encouraged to actually buy from you.
Once you have your e-Book ready and you have your e-Book cover, you then need
to start the promotion in earnest and there are a myriad of ways that you can
promote an e-Book online. These might include: link building, search engine
optimization, promotion in ezines, advertising online with Pay Per Click, and
search engine placement.
